JoBear Posted January 3, 2010 Share Posted January 3, 2010 it's these rules again: Christmas Day, Boxing Day, New Year's Day & 2 January Holiday: These public holidays are observed on the actual day when they fall on a weekday. When they fall on a Saturday/Sunday: If the employee would normally have worked on the Saturday/Sunday, the public holiday is observed on the Saturday/Sunday If the employee would not normally have worked on the Saturday/Sunday, the public holiday is observed on the following Monday/Tuesday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

JoBear Posted January 3, 2010 Share Posted January 3, 2010 although it's an interesting one, if it was another public holiday like say good friday and she agreed to work she's entitled to time and a half but not a day in lieu. i guess because the holiday transfers and the monday is the day she normally works, that gets treated as her 2nd of january holiday. all you really get off DOL is: Public holidays that fall at the weekend are treated in two ways: Christmas and New Year holidays are “mondayised” (i.e. shifted to the following Monday or Tuesday) for those who do not normally work at the weekend, but are celebrated at the weekend by those that do. However, no employee is entitled to more than four days worth of public holiday payments for these holidays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
